Why British expats in France should review their finances post Brexit

Following the UK ’ s departure from the European Union in 2021 , Jennie Poate , head of operations at Beacon Global Wealth , financial advisors for expats in France , advises on changes that may affect some people .
How has Brexit affected banking and finance services for expats
in France ?

The changes brought about by Brexit mean that some companies no longer have a European licence for financial and insurance services . Essentially they are no longer able to support offshore clients . Even the big banks such as Barclays have been in the headlines for sending letters saying they will close bank accounts for non-residents .
This caused causing concern and upset for many people . There are though on line bank accounts which offer multicurrency accounts which may provide a simple solution for those who are tech savvy and want to maintain a sterling account – those with pension income for example . ( Ed ’ s note : for instance Revolut and Transferwise ).
Pensions post Brexit for expats in France
Some Brits with pensions in the UK are having issues , for instance Aviva not allowing online access for clients .
When it comes to pensions that are in drawdown or not yet in payment , a France-based advisor who is qualified to advise on both the UK and French finances can help you asses your current arrangements and compare alternatives which might hold greater flexibility .
